Yahya related to me from Malik from Zayd ibn Aslam from
his father that Umar ibn al-Khattab gave a mawla of his
called Hunayy charge over the hima. He said, "Hunayy! Do
not harm the people. Fear the supplication of the wronged,
for the supplication of the wronged is answered. Let the
one with a small herd of camels and the one with a small
herd of sheep enter, but be wary of the livestock of Ibn
Awf and the livestock of Ibn Affan. If their livestock are
destroyed, they will return to palm-trees and agriculture.
If the livestock of the one with a small herd of camels
and the one with a small herd of sheep are destroyed, he
will bring his children to me crying, 'Amir al-muminin!
Amir al-Muminin!' Shall I neglect them? Water and
pasturage are of less value to me than gold and silver. By
Allah, they think that I have wronged them. This is their
land and their water. They fought for it in the jahiliyya
and became muslims on it in Islam. By He in whose hand my
self is! Were it not for the mounts which I give to be
ridden in the way of Allah, I would not have turned a span
of their land into hima."
